Chapter 2 - The Trial of the Void

It was supposed to be just another boring day.

The school bell rang at 2:45 PM. Students rushed out like prisoners freed from a sentence. Laughter, footsteps, and gossip echoed across the courtyard.

But Lu Benxu… didn't move.

He sat alone on the edge of the rooftop, watching the gray sky stretch endlessly.

No friends. No reason to smile. Just silence — the kind that clung to your soul.

His cold black eyes scanned the world below as if looking for something… anything.

He found nothing.

"Another pointless day," he muttered.

He stood up, slinging his torn bag over his shoulder and brushing off dust from his uniform. He began to walk — toward the stairs.

But before he could take a step—

Everything froze.

The wind stopped. The birds mid-flight hung still in the sky. Even the ticking wall clock paused, stuck at 2:46 PM.

Then came a sound — not a sound, but a presence.

A whisper. Ancient. Distant.

Calling his name.

"Lu Benxu... You have been chosen."

A glowing sigil burst beneath his feet — circular, etched with strange symbols that shimmered in golden light. His eyes widened for the first time in years.

"What… is this?"

The world twisted. Space folded. Light collapsed into a single point.

And then — he vanished.

[Within the Trial Dimension]

Benxu's body dropped onto a stone floor with a harsh thud. The air here was cold — not temperature cold, but cosmic cold.

He stood in a floating realm. Pieces of broken stars hovered around him. Strange dark mist curled around the void.

A massive voice boomed — like thunder cracking through space.

"Welcome, Vessel Candidate."

"You stand in the Trial of Origin. Your essence will be tested. Your soul will be judged."

Lu Benxu looked around, expressionless.

"Is this… a dream?"

"No."

"This is the truth beneath all lies."

In front of him, a monster emerged — 10 feet tall, with six eyes and a blade for an arm. Its body was stitched from shadows, its roar shook the very floor.

"Survive," the voice said.

"Or die."

[Trial Begins]

Lu Benxu's heart beat once — heavy and real.

He had no weapons. No powers. No instructions.

But something inside him — something buried deep — awoke.

As the monster charged, Lu didn't flinch.

He sidestepped with inhuman speed, narrowly dodging a swipe meant to slice him in half.

"...My body moved on its own?"

Another attack. Benxu ducked, rolled, grabbed a shard of broken stone — and flung it straight into one of the monster's eyes.

It screamed.

The voice echoed again.

"Awakening detected."

A pulse of green light erupted from his chest. A fragment — a crystal, glowing with ancient power — embedded itself inside him.

[Gem Fragment Resonating…]

[Trial Ability Unlocked: Temporal Blink]

The world slowed down.

Lu saw the monster move… frame by frame.

And in that moment, he moved faster than thought.

He appeared behind the creature — picked up a glowing spear from a floating platform — and plunged it into the monster's core.

"Let's end this."

One strike.

The Trial ended.

Benxu stood, panting. Blood ran down his arm, but his eyes... were glowing.

"What… was that?" he whispered.

The voice returned — softer this time.

"You are not complete."

"You possess only one fragment."

"To restore the Gem… defeat the beasts born from its scattered shards."

"You are... the Inheritor."

[Trial Completed: 1/∞]

[Returning to Earth Realm in 3... 2... 1…]
